Skip to content
  • Home
  • Aktuell
  • Tags
  • 0 Ungelesen 0
  • Kategorien
  • Unreplied
  • Beliebt
  • GitHub
  • Docu
  • Hilfe
Skins
  • Light
  • Brite
  • Cerulean
  • Cosmo
  • Flatly
  • Journal
  • Litera
  • Lumen
  • Lux
  • Materia
  • Minty
  • Morph
  • Pulse
  • Sandstone
  • Simplex
  • Sketchy
  • Spacelab
  • United
  • Yeti
  • Zephyr
  • Dark
  • Cyborg
  • Darkly
  • Quartz
  • Slate
  • Solar
  • Superhero
  • Vapor

  • Standard: (Kein Skin)
  • Kein Skin
Einklappen
ioBroker Logo

Community Forum

donate donate
  1. ioBroker Community Home
  2. Deutsch
  3. ioBroker Allgemein
  4. NPM spinnt!

NEWS

  • Weihnachtsangebot 2025! 🎄
    BluefoxB
    Bluefox
    22
    1
    1.2k

  • UPDATE 31.10.: Amazon Alexa - ioBroker Skill läuft aus ?
    apollon77A
    apollon77
    48
    3
    9.2k

  • Monatsrückblick – September 2025
    BluefoxB
    Bluefox
    14
    1
    2.5k

NPM spinnt!

Geplant Angeheftet Gesperrt Verschoben ioBroker Allgemein
38 Beiträge 12 Kommentatoren 5.0k Aufrufe
  • Älteste zuerst
  • Neuste zuerst
  • Meiste Stimmen
Antworten
  • In einem neuen Thema antworten
Anmelden zum Antworten
Dieses Thema wurde gelöscht. Nur Nutzer mit entsprechenden Rechten können es sehen.
  • G Offline
    G Offline
    green50
    schrieb am zuletzt editiert von
    #1

    Seit ein paar Tagen mosert ioBroker wegen der npm-Version herum. Nun klappt die Aktualisierung von z.B. des Admin-Adapters nicht mehr. Muss dann jedes mal den Adapter mit:

    cd /opt/iobroker
    iobroker stop admin
    npm install iobroker.admin
    iobroker upload admin
    iobroker start admin
    

    neu installieren um weiter arbeiten zu können. Dabei wird mir folgendes angezeigt:

    Update available 5.5.1 → 5.7.1
    Run npm i -g npm to update
    

    Führe ich diesen Befehl jedoch aus, wird mir mit````
    npm -v

    
    Jemand eine Idee wie man ioBroker wieder zur zufriedenstellenden Mitarbeit überreden kann?
    1 Antwort Letzte Antwort
    0
    • arteckA Offline
      arteckA Offline
      arteck
      Developer Most Active
      schrieb am zuletzt editiert von
      #2

      was sagt

      which npm
      

      ansosnten

      npm i -g npm@>=5.7.1
      

      sollte helfen

      zigbee hab ich, zwave auch, nuc's genauso und HA auch

      1 Antwort Letzte Antwort
      0
      • M Offline
        M Offline
        mikiline
        schrieb am zuletzt editiert von
        #3

        Hab heute morgen auch den Upgrade des Admin Adapters gemacht. Allerdings übers Webinterface…..ganz normaler Adapter Update. Danach bekam ich die Admin Instanz auch nicht mehr zum Laufen, bzw. kein Webinterface mehr.

        Backup von heute Nacht zurückgespielt ;)

        1 Antwort Letzte Antwort
        0
        • wendy2702W Offline
          wendy2702W Offline
          wendy2702
          schrieb am zuletzt editiert von
          #4

          Hi,

          den Befehl:

          npm i -g npm
          ````muss man scheinbar zwingend zweimal ausführen.
          
          Der richtige Befehl für Upgrade auf NPM 5.7.1 sieht allerdings so aus:
          
          

          sudo npm i -g "npm@>=5.7.1"

          Bitte keine Fragen per PN, die gehören ins Forum!

          Benutzt das Voting rechts unten im Beitrag wenn er euch geholfen hat.

          1 Antwort Letzte Antwort
          0
          • eric2905E Offline
            eric2905E Offline
            eric2905
            schrieb am zuletzt editiert von
            #5

            Viel spannender wären Infos wie:

            Welches Repository?

            Was sagt das Log dazu (die zwei Zeilen sind sehr dürftig)?

            Gruß,

            Eric

            Roses are red, violets are blue,

            if I listen to metal, my neighbours do too

            1 Antwort Letzte Antwort
            0
            • apollon77A Offline
              apollon77A Offline
              apollon77
              schrieb am zuletzt editiert von
              #6

              @mikiline:

              Hab heute morgen auch den Upgrade des Admin Adapters gemacht. Allerdings übers Webinterface…..ganz normaler Adapter Update. Danach bekam ich die Admin Instanz auch nicht mehr zum Laufen, bzw. kein Webinterface mehr.

              Backup von heute Nacht zurückgespielt ;) `

              Das war die Fehlerhafte 3.3.2 … bitte 3.3.3 nehmen

              Beitrag hat geholfen? Votet rechts unten im Beitrag :-) https://paypal.me/Apollon77 / https://github.com/sponsors/Apollon77

              • Debug-Log für Instanz einschalten? Admin -> Instanzen -> Expertenmodus -> Instanz aufklappen - Loglevel ändern
              • Logfiles auf Platte /opt/iobroker/log/… nutzen, Admin schneidet Zeilen ab
              1 Antwort Letzte Antwort
              0
              • G Offline
                G Offline
                green50
                schrieb am zuletzt editiert von
                #7

                Hallo````
                which npm

                
                

                npm i -g npm@>=5.7.1
                ````- auch 2x hintereinander ändert nichts. Ebenso > sudo npm i -g "npm@>=5.7.1"

                npm-Version bleibt standhaft auf 5.5.1 …

                1 Antwort Letzte Antwort
                0
                • apollon77A Offline
                  apollon77A Offline
                  apollon77
                  schrieb am zuletzt editiert von
                  #8

                  sudo??

                  Beitrag hat geholfen? Votet rechts unten im Beitrag :-) https://paypal.me/Apollon77 / https://github.com/sponsors/Apollon77

                  • Debug-Log für Instanz einschalten? Admin -> Instanzen -> Expertenmodus -> Instanz aufklappen - Loglevel ändern
                  • Logfiles auf Platte /opt/iobroker/log/… nutzen, Admin schneidet Zeilen ab
                  1 Antwort Letzte Antwort
                  0
                  • wendy2702W Offline
                    wendy2702W Offline
                    wendy2702
                    schrieb am zuletzt editiert von
                    #9
                    npm i -g npm
                    ````das sollte 2x ausgeführt werden… habe ich das mißverständlich geschrieben !?

                    Bitte keine Fragen per PN, die gehören ins Forum!

                    Benutzt das Voting rechts unten im Beitrag wenn er euch geholfen hat.

                    1 Antwort Letzte Antwort
                    0
                    • G Offline
                      G Offline
                      green50
                      schrieb am zuletzt editiert von
                      #10

                      @wendy2702:

                      npm i -g npm
                      ````das sollte 2x ausgeführt werden… habe ich das mißverständlich geschrieben !? `  
                      

                      auch damit keine Änderung …

                      kann man npm komplett runterwerfen und neu installieren?

                      1 Antwort Letzte Antwort
                      0
                      • wendy2702W Offline
                        wendy2702W Offline
                        wendy2702
                        schrieb am zuletzt editiert von
                        #11

                        Zum entfernen:

                        sudo apt-get remove nodejs
                        
                        sudo apt-get remove npm
                        
                        Then go to /etc/apt/sources.list.d and remove any node list if you have. Then do a
                        
                        sudo apt-get update
                        
                        Check for any .npm or .node folder in your home folder and delete those.
                        
                        If you type
                        
                        which node
                        

                        Oder aus der iobroker Docu: http://www.iobroker.net/docu/?page_id=5106&lang=de

                            Kernel Update: sudo apt-get update && sudo apt-get upgrade
                            Auf bereits vorhandene Versionen von nodejs und npm testen.
                                node -v
                                nodejs -v
                                npm -v
                            nur wenn ALLE diese Befehle kein Ergebnis bringen unter 5\. weitermachen, sonst
                                Die alten node & node.js Versionen deinstallieren
                                    sudo apt-get --purge remove node
                                    sudo apt-get --purge remove nodejs
                                    sudo apt-get autoremove
                                    sudo reboot
                            Node.js neu installieren für Linux und Raspberry 2/3
                                curl -sL https://deb.nodesource.com/setup_6.x | sudo -E bash -
                                sudo apt-get install -y build-essential libavahi-compat-libdnssd-dev libudev-dev nodejs
                                reboot
                            Node.js neu installieren nur für Raspberry Pi1 (sollte es beim download zu einer Fehlermeldung kommen, bitte unter http://nodejs.org/dist/latest-v6.x/ die aktuelle Versionsnummer heraussuchen und in den Befehlen 1-3 ersetzen)
                                wget http://nodejs.org/dist/latest-v6.x/node-v6.12.2-linux-armv6l.tar.gz
                                tar -xvf node-v6.12.2-linux-armv6l.tar.gz
                                cd node-v6.12.2-linux-armv6l
                                sudo cp -R * /usr/local/
                                sudo ln -s /usr/local/bin/node /usr/bin/nodejs
                            als Root über Putty anmelden
                            Nach der Installation muss das Kommando “node -v” die Version von node.js zurückgeben. Falls es nicht passiert, dann sollte noch ein Alias erzeugt werden:
                            sudo ln -s /usr/local/bin/nodejs /usr/bin/node
                        
                        

                        Ob und welche Einwirkungen das komplette entfernen auf deine Installation hat kann ich dir allerdings nicht sagen.

                        Je nachdem welches Linux du hast die apt Befehle ohne das "-get" ausführen.

                        Kannst aber vorher noch einmal das versuchen:

                        npm install npm@latest -g
                        

                        Bitte keine Fragen per PN, die gehören ins Forum!

                        Benutzt das Voting rechts unten im Beitrag wenn er euch geholfen hat.

                        1 Antwort Letzte Antwort
                        0
                        • AlCalzoneA Offline
                          AlCalzoneA Offline
                          AlCalzone
                          Developer
                          schrieb am zuletzt editiert von
                          #12

                          @wendy2702:

                          npm i -g npm
                          ````das sollte 2x ausgeführt werden… `  
                          

                          Sehe immer noch keinen Grund, warum das 2x ausgeführt werden sollte… Bei mir hats bisher immer mit 1x funktioniert.

                          Warum `sudo` böse ist: https://forum.iobroker.net/post/17109

                          1 Antwort Letzte Antwort
                          0
                          • AlCalzoneA Offline
                            AlCalzoneA Offline
                            AlCalzone
                            Developer
                            schrieb am zuletzt editiert von
                            #13

                            @green50:

                            Führe ich diesen Befehl jedoch aus, wird mir mitnpm -vwieder die alte Version 5.5.1 angezeigt … `
                            Ist die Installation denn auch erfolgreich durchgelaufen oder gabs Fehler? Npm musst du in der Regel mit````
                            sudo npm i -g npm

                            Warum `sudo` böse ist: https://forum.iobroker.net/post/17109

                            1 Antwort Letzte Antwort
                            0
                            • wendy2702W Offline
                              wendy2702W Offline
                              wendy2702
                              schrieb am zuletzt editiert von
                              #14

                              Warum 2x kann ich dir auch nicht sagen.

                              Ich weiß nur das ich es bei mir machen musste.

                              Bitte keine Fragen per PN, die gehören ins Forum!

                              Benutzt das Voting rechts unten im Beitrag wenn er euch geholfen hat.

                              1 Antwort Letzte Antwort
                              0
                              • G Offline
                                G Offline
                                green50
                                schrieb am zuletzt editiert von
                                #15

                                Ich habe alles ausprobiert.

                                Im Pfad /usr/lib/node_modules/npm den kompletten Ordner gelöscht und dann neu installiert.

                                node -v ergibt: v6.13.1

                                npm -v ergibt: 5.5.1

                                Ich geb's auf.

                                1 Antwort Letzte Antwort
                                0
                                • lobomauL Offline
                                  lobomauL Offline
                                  lobomau
                                  schrieb am zuletzt editiert von
                                  #16

                                  Bei mir lief es ohne Probleme, nur ein Klick unter Adapter-Updates.

                                  System: Ubuntu Server

                                  npm version 3.10.10

                                  node version 6.13.1

                                  Update Admin 3.3.1 -> 3.3.3

                                  Host: NUC8i3 mit Proxmox:

                                  • ioBroker CT Debian 13, npm 10.9.4, nodejs 22.21.0
                                  • Slave: Pi4
                                  1 Antwort Letzte Antwort
                                  0
                                  • wendy2702W Offline
                                    wendy2702W Offline
                                    wendy2702
                                    schrieb am zuletzt editiert von
                                    #17

                                    @green50:

                                    Ich habe alles ausprobiert.

                                    Im Pfad /usr/lib/node_modules/npm den kompletten Ordner gelöscht und dann neu installiert.

                                    node -v ergibt: v6.13.1

                                    npm -v ergibt: 5.5.1

                                    Ich geb's auf. `

                                    Laut deiner abfrage liegt die benutze NPM Version auch hier:

                                    > spuckt /usr/local/bin/npm aus.

                                    Bitte keine Fragen per PN, die gehören ins Forum!

                                    Benutzt das Voting rechts unten im Beitrag wenn er euch geholfen hat.

                                    1 Antwort Letzte Antwort
                                    0
                                    • G Offline
                                      G Offline
                                      green50
                                      schrieb am zuletzt editiert von
                                      #18

                                      @wendy2702:

                                      Laut deiner abfrage liegt die benutze NPM Version auch hier:

                                      > spuckt /usr/local/bin/npm aus. `

                                      Und hier liegt sie nicht richtig? Ich habe nichts geändert …

                                      1 Antwort Letzte Antwort
                                      0
                                      • wendy2702W Offline
                                        wendy2702W Offline
                                        wendy2702
                                        schrieb am zuletzt editiert von
                                        #19

                                        Ich habe die auf allen Installationen hier:

                                        root@pi-iobroker:/dev# which npm
                                        /usr/bin/npm
                                        
                                        

                                        Bitte keine Fragen per PN, die gehören ins Forum!

                                        Benutzt das Voting rechts unten im Beitrag wenn er euch geholfen hat.

                                        1 Antwort Letzte Antwort
                                        0
                                        • G Offline
                                          G Offline
                                          green50
                                          schrieb am zuletzt editiert von
                                          #20

                                          @wendy2702:

                                          Ich habe die auf allen Installationen hier:

                                          root@pi-iobroker:/dev# which npm
                                          /usr/bin/npm
                                          
                                          ```` `  
                                          

                                          Ja das mag ein Grund sein. Jedoch funktioniert ioBroker ja auch wenn npm in einem anderen Pfad liegt … Die Meldung dass 5.7.1 verlangt wird - aber trotz Upgrade nicht auf 5.7.1 gehoben wird, habe ich ja nur, wenn ich auf Aktualisieren gehe. Wenn ich einen Adapter neu installiere, anstatt ihn über die Admin-Oberfläche zu aktualisieren, wird er anstandslos installiert ...

                                          iobroker	2018-03-15 16:09:05.451	error	!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!
                                          iobroker	2018-03-15 16:09:05.451	error	You need to make sure to repeat this step after installing an update to NodeJS and/or npm
                                          iobroker	2018-03-15 16:09:05.451	error	use "npm install -g npm@>=5.7.1" to install a supported version of npm 5!
                                          iobroker	2018-03-15 16:09:05.451	error	Please use "npm install -g npm@4" to downgrade npm to 4.x or
                                          iobroker	2018-03-15 16:09:05.451	error	!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!NPM 5 is only supported starting with version 5.7.1!
                                          

                                          Ich denke der neue Admin-Adapter und der js-controller hatten in letzter Zeit ziemlich viel Updates erfahren und Software ist immer in Bewegung.

                                          1 Antwort Letzte Antwort
                                          0
                                          Antworten
                                          • In einem neuen Thema antworten
                                          Anmelden zum Antworten
                                          • Älteste zuerst
                                          • Neuste zuerst
                                          • Meiste Stimmen


                                          Support us

                                          ioBroker
                                          Community Adapters
                                          Donate
                                          FAQ Cloud / IOT
                                          HowTo: Node.js-Update
                                          HowTo: Backup/Restore
                                          Downloads
                                          BLOG

                                          714

                                          Online

                                          32.5k

                                          Benutzer

                                          81.7k

                                          Themen

                                          1.3m

                                          Beiträge
                                          Community
                                          Impressum | Datenschutz-Bestimmungen | Nutzungsbedingungen | Einwilligungseinstellungen
                                          ioBroker Community 2014-2025
                                          logo
                                          • Anmelden

                                          • Du hast noch kein Konto? Registrieren

                                          • Anmelden oder registrieren, um zu suchen
                                          • Erster Beitrag
                                            Letzter Beitrag
                                          0
                                          • Home
                                          • Aktuell
                                          • Tags
                                          • Ungelesen 0
                                          • Kategorien
                                          • Unreplied
                                          • Beliebt
                                          • GitHub
                                          • Docu
                                          • Hilfe